As a Fiber Splicer, you will have the opportunity to utilize your skill set, work in a safety-minded environment, and join us in expanding technology for a better community.
Duties & Responsibilities
• Splice single mode and multimode fiber
• Fusion splice and terminate various types of fiber optic connectors
• Interpret buried underground and aerial as-builts and splice schedules
• Installation and dressing of fiber optic cabling
• Troubleshoot fiber optic links and certify fiber optic links
• Respond to emergency situations to restore service outages
• Report splicing matrix
Skills & Qualifications
• 2+ years of experience in fiber splicing required
• Demonstrated leadership skills required
• Ability to work under pressure and in a fast paced and quickly changing environment
• Ability to travel and work on call including evenings and weekends as needed
• Ability to work outdoors in all weather conditions
• Ability to work and climb up to 35 feet
• Ability to maintain a positive attitude and strong work ethic
•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ite (Excel and Word)
• Excellent verbal communication skills
• Excellent organizational skills and strong attention to detail
• Valid driver’s license required

The Tower Technician III will install, maintain, and operate wired, wireless, fiber optic and microwave telecommunications equipment and systems. As a Tower Technician III, support will be provided in the maintenance and operation of generators, HVAC, and telecommunication site infrastructures.
Essential Job Duties and Responsibilities
- Understands and implements MasTec Network Solutions (MNS) Health Safety and Environmental Policies. (Safety Manual).
- Understands and implements Industry standards (OSHA, TIA10-48, NATE CTS and ANSI)
- Climbing towers and ladders at various heights
- Erection of various tower types
- Off-loading material and inventory
- Preparation and cleaning of sites
- Installation of new carriers on new build and existing towers
- Assists in tower erection using helicopters, cranes and gin poles
- Assists in the assembly of monopole, all weld and knock down self-support and guyed towers
- Assists in the antenna installation of microwave parabolic 1 to 15-foot, VHF, UHF, cellular and FM broadcast antennas
- Assists in the transmission line and installation of foam/air dielectric coaxial, hardline and elliptical waveguide.
- Assists in the installation of all aspects of ell site foundations, grounding and conduits, with electrical installations where applicable.
- Serve as a mentor to new less experienced technicians
- Other duties as assigned.
Education and Training
- High school diploma or general education degree (GED)
Skills and Experience
- Minimum of 4 years tower experience
- Ability to read, comprehend and carry out instructions per prints
- Working knowledge of safety standards and regulations.
- NWSA certification is a plus
- Industrial first aid
- Must have the ability to climb towers, be able to pick up 50 lbs., and capable of working up to 12 hours.
- Must have a valid driver’s license and driving record meeting the company policy conditions
Working Conditions
- Must be available to work weekends and/or nights, in extreme weather conditions if necessary
- Must have the ability and be willing to travel extensively, as required for job related functions.
- Must be able to work out of market or away from home as work demands.
Salary Range
- $25.00 - $29.00 an hour

This position will be responsible for installation, commissioning, integration, troubleshooting, and testing GSM, UMTS, and LTE equipment at customer Cell Sites.
Essential Job Duties and Responsibilities
To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ill, and/or ability required.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ions of the job.
- New Site Builds (NSB), Carrier Adds, Indoor systems, CRAN, COWs including all necessary elements; installation, commissioning, integration, testing, transport, alarm, power, ground, SIAD, functional and E911 call testing.
- Technical Site Surveys including reviewing and creating associated schematics.
- Prepare and submit accurate documentation of services
- Produce post implementation site packages and field reports including pictures, email and Excel reports
- Assess product/equipment performance based on field support data and recommends modifications and improvements
- Provide daily technical and customer support for installed telecommunications systems; troubleshoot, diagnose and resolve issues and alarms.
- Investigate equipment failures to diagnose and improve systems issues
- Installs, repairs, and maintains equipment in the field. Ensures that tools and test equipment are properly maintained
- Estimate time to complete installations and maintenance updates
- Order, install, scan, and return parts and manages the part cycle system
- Ensure compliance with the company’s safety and environmental policies
- Assist with other duties as assigned.
Skills and Experience
- Bachelor’s degree in Electronics and Communications Engineering or related field preferred. Associates Degree or High School diploma and equivalent related experience considered.
- 2+ years of technical experience
- Valid Driver’s License
- ALU Certifications a plus; ALU Tools Expert.
- 1 – 3 years LTE & UMTS integration experience required.
- Nokia / Ericsson Certifications Required.
- Ability to work within Maintenance Window hours (midnight to 6am) or daytime as scheduled based on project scope and adhere reliably to schedule.
- Knowledgeable in cabling (RF, Electrical CAT5/6, T1 Copper, Fiber) and other advanced technologies.
- Equipment utilized: BB6630, BB5216, DUS, DUL/DUW/DUG. RBS6000 Series including LTE 6601, RBS3000. Radios including: RRUS-11, RRUS-32, Series 44, AIR Products
- Ability to represent company with professionalism.
- Ability to travel within a region, market, or out of market on a project basis.
- Comfortable working outdoors in all types of weather throughout the year.
- Ability to use technical skills to work independently and within a team and execute responsibilities as well as solve problems.
- Ability to utilize and care for company vehicle and expensive test equipment.
- Ability to lift 50 lbs. and climb a 12 ft. ladder; able to use basic hand tools.
- OSHA 10 or 30 Certificate preferred
- Computer and MS Office proficient.
- Proficient in customer specifications and standards
- Operating Telecommunications Test Equipment Expert.
- Test & Turn-up Experience preferred.
- Customer Service – Responds promptly to customer needs; solicits customer feedback to improve partnership.
- Communication Skills – Excellent written and verbal communication skills; speaks clearly and persuasively in positive or negative situations; listens and gets clarification; demonstrates group presentation skills.
- Planning/Organizing – Excellent time management and organizational skills; sets goals and objectives; develops realistic action plans.
Dependability – Follows instructions, responds to management direction
